Cancer of unknown primary site is a common clinical entity, accounting for 5% of all cancer patients. The diagnostic evaluation of these patients must permit to exclude treatable tumors. We reviewed the charts of 85 patients admitted with this diagnostic. We propose an algorithm for investigation of these patients.
